Project SINS

The SINS subproject within the former section Software Engineering has resulted in the promotion of Bastiaan Schönhage. (See below.) The theme of the subproject concerned the use of animations and visualisation to display business process simulation results in a hypermedia context. During the project the focus shifted towards visualisation, in particular business visualisation. In Bastiaan thesis several case studies can be found illustrating the use of visualisation to support business processes and in particular decision making processes.

Promotion Bastiaan Schonhage

Supervisors: Prof. Dr J.C. van Vliet & Dr A. Eliëns.

The title of Bastiaans Ph.D. thesis is:

Diva: Architectural Perspectives on Information Visualization

The goal of the Diva (Distributed Visualization Architecture) project is to develop a distributed software architecture for interactive visualization of dynamic information. To support multiple users with different information requirements, the architecture supports multiple perspectives/views on the information. Additionally, simulations are included as dynamic sources of data and information. To improve the usability of visualization, user-interaction and user-collaboration are integrated into the architecture.

To illustrate the architecture, several prototype implementations have been built allowing multiple users to visualize (in 2D and in 3D) data coming from shared databases and simulations.
